The drawings show one embodiment of the present invention; Fig. 1 is an exploded perspective view, Fig. 2 is a sectional view of a pipe installed under the floor and fixed to the floor with a joint, and Fig. 3 is a cross-sectional view of the pipe installed under the floor. FIG. 4 is a sectional view showing a state in which a standpipe on the floor is connected, and FIG. 4 is a partially cutaway perspective view showing another embodiment of the joint. In the figure, 1 is a floor, 2 is a pipe, 3 is a joint, 4 is a cylindrical part of the joint, and 5 is a flange of the joint.

継手。 A pipe joint that connects pipes penetrating through a floor, etc., with a joint, and the joint consists of a cylindrical part to which a pipe can be attached from both ends, and a flange perforated on the outer surface of one end of the cylindrical part. Insert the cylindrical part of the joint into the through hole drilled in the hole, attach the pipes to both ends of the cylindrical part, and
A pipe joint characterized in that the flange of the joint is fixed to a floor, etc.
